Peter Archibald, B. Eng., CSS

Engineering & Construction Manager

  • Over 20 years experience in project management,¬†construction management, and heavy lift planning and engineering
  • Bachelor in Industrial Engineering, Certified Construction Safety Supervisor
  • Certified ISO9000 Internal Quality Auditor
  • Designed, coordinated, and ¬†supervised the civil construction and erection activities for many wind turbine projects throughout Atlantic Canada
  • Coordinates all engineering, GIS, environmental, and permitting¬†activities
Our Company Photo

Every revolution is about power.